Analysis

The most recent figure for net oda received per capita in Ukraine is 1,032 current US$, measured in 2023. That is the highest value across all 19 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 47.6% on the previous year and up 5,919.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, net oda received per capita in Ukraine peaked at 1,032 current US$ in 2023 and was at its lowest, 8.49 current US$, in 2005.

That places Ukraine 10th out of 170 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the top 10%.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Net official development assistance (ODA) per capita consists of disbursements of loans made on concessional terms (net of repayments of principal) and grants by official agencies of the members of the Development Assistance Committee (DAC), by multilateral institutions, and by non-DAC countries to promote economic development and welfare in countries and territories in the DAC list of ODA recipients; and is calculated by dividing net ODA received by the midyear population estimate. It includes loans with a grant element of at least 25 percent (calculated at a rate of discount of 10 percent).
